Need some help with Newbie stuff here

I originally used the scope with a rifle and want to move it to another one. It was zero'ed and zero stop works fine.

I can't seem to deactivate the zero stop set with original rifle.

I unscrewed the screw on turret and no matter what I do, it stays @ 2nd revolution (Yellow indicator) and cannot seem to 'Deactivate the zero reset'

How do I Deactivate zero stop and make it to factory original configutation?

No matter what I do, the max 'UP' is @ 2nd rev (Yellow) 12.2Mil and 0.6 below zero (which is normal). It always stuck @ 2nd revolution (Yellow) no matter what I do.

Okay here you go... Turn the scope until it bottoms out I assume that is what you are showing in picture#2 @roughly 13.4 mils....

Unscrew the turret screws and turn the turret up to max elevation at 26 mils then retighten the screws....

Turn turret down you should have full travel again
